Collectors in Liberty show interest in rare holofoil cards, first editions, promo and variant cards unique to special events, and professionally graded cards that provide authenticity and condition assurance. Vintage and recent expansion sets both contribute to demand, especially cards representing powerful or iconic Digimon characters.
Condition and rarity set the foundation for value, with first edition markings and limited print runs considered highly significant. Grading adds credibility and boosts prices. Buyer interest fluctuates based on character popularity and recent sales data, which local sellers track to price fairly.
Local stores allow sellers to engage directly with the community and evaluate card conditions in person. Online marketplaces extend reach and can sometimes yield higher offers due to competition among buyers.
